Output ef8416f86185e3bce977a24d68269cbb996f18d6d10d1dff2f6f76fb2c233b0c:2

value
6717
script pubkey
OP_0 OP_PUSHBYTES_32 cc861c29e15ca95ca645c45c0bda4e4cb7e736ccbfca36c4a9698637ee2dd68d
address
bc1qejrpc20ptj54efj9c3wqhkjwfjm7wdkvhl9rd39fdxrr0m3d66xswt75ec
transaction
ef8416f86185e3bce977a24d68269cbb996f18d6d10d1dff2f6f76fb2c233b0c
confirmations
202564
spent
true